I really like this place. Mostly because it is away from all the craziness Big Bear City brings (including the people). This restaurant sits on the other side of Big Bear lake, well, the only cafe on this side actually. So if you find yourself here, Fawnskin, you don't really have much of a choice probably unless you want to drive all the way around back to Big Bear City/Village area.
During Covid, they completely close the inside and it is not accessible for customers at all, even the restroom. Which is understandable because it is a mom and pop place and the inside is small anyway.
You order through the Intercome, which in my opinion makes the sweet lady's voice really hard to hear. The intercome is loud but it kind of scramble her voice... The sweet lady would take your order when you are ready and there is a side window where you come to get your food when she calls you. Please be patient with her, she is working hard and I'm sure they are all working hard in the kitchen.
Seatings are all outdoor. There was lots of snow when we came this time so maneuvering past the snow or puddle of melted snow could be a challenge. Space is very limited and so is parking so if you pass by it and there is no parking, you know there is no seating at the moment.
Nonetheless, I would still recommend this place because it is tucked away on the other more peaceful side of Big Bear. Food is very basic so don't expect fancy or try to customize your orders, they won't do it. Breakfast menu stops at noon and Lunch menu starts at 11am. No substitution. No special order. The end! :)
